JavaScript流程控制详解:顺序、选择与循环

需积分: 48 96 下载量 105 浏览量 更新于2024-08-08 收藏 9.7MB PDF 举报
"流程控制是编程语言的基础,JavaScript中有顺序结构、选择结构和循环结构三种控制方式。顺序结构是最基本的,代码按顺序执行。选择结构包括条件判断,如if语句,用于根据条件执行不同分支。循环结构包括for、while等,用于重复执行某段代码直到满足特定条件。JavaScript基础教程结合实战经验,深入浅出地讲解流程控制、函数、字符串、数组等基本语法和技术核心,如DOM操作和事件处理。" 在编程世界中,流程控制是不可或缺的一部分,它决定了程序如何执行指令。在JavaScript中,我们有三种主要的流程控制机制: 1. **顺序结构**:这是最基本的执行模式,程序中的每条语句按照它们在代码中的出现顺序逐行执行。例如,在HTML中插入JavaScript代码,浏览器会从上到下解析并执行这些代码。 ```javascript console.log("Start"); console.log("Middle"); console.log("End"); ``` 在这个例子中,"Start"、"Middle"和"End"将按照它们在代码中的顺序依次输出。 2. **选择结构**:选择结构允许程序根据条件来决定执行哪一段代码。JavaScript中的`if`和`else`语句是这种结构的例子。例如: ```javascript let age = 18; if (age >= 18) { console.log("You are an adult."); } else { console.log("You are not an adult yet."); } ``` 在这个例子中,如果`age`变量的值大于或等于18,程序将输出"You are an adult.",否则输出"You are not an adult yet."。 3. **循环结构**:循环结构允许代码块重复执行,直到满足某个条件为止。JavaScript提供了`for`、`while`、`do...while`等循环语句。例如,使用`for`循环打印1到10的数字: ```javascript for (let i = 1; i <= 10; i++) { console.log(i); } ``` 这段代码会从1打印到10,因为每次循环都会检查`i`是否小于或等于10,然后递增`i`的值。 在《Web前端开发精品课 - JavaScript基础教程》中,作者莫振杰结合实际开发经验,不仅讲解了这些基础知识,还涵盖了JavaScript的其他重要概念,如函数、字符串、数组以及DOM操作、事件处理等核心技术。通过实例和实践,帮助学习者构建编程思维,提升实战技能,从而更有效地掌握JavaScript这门复杂的语言。书中的内容设计既注重理论知识的传授,又强调实际应用,旨在帮助初学者找到正确的学习路径,避免陷入学习困境。